Editing in process:

Unit: Sergt Co. C and Co. F 4th W Va Inf; C 2 W Va. Vet Infantry
https://www.nps.gov/civilwar/search-battle-units-detail.htm?battleUnitCode=UWV0002RIU

Ancestry: "U.S., Civil War Soldier Records and Profiles, 1861-1865", collection.
Name: David Gatchell
Enlistment Age: 36
Birth Date: 1825
Enlistment Date: 15 Jul 1861
Enlistment Rank: Sergeant
Muster Date: 15 Jul 1861
Muster Place: West Virginia
Muster Company: F
Muster Regiment: 4th Infantry
Muster Regiment Type: Infantry
Muster Information: Enlisted
Muster Out Date: 10 Dec 1864
Muster Out Information: Transferred
Side of War: Union
Survived War: Yes
Additional Notes 2: Muster 2 Date: 10 Dec 1864; Muster 2 Place: West Virginia; Muster 2 Unit: 3148; Muster 2 Company: C; Muster 2 Regiment: 2nd Vet Infantry; Muster 2 Regiment Type: Infantry; Muster 2 Information: Transferred; MusterOut 2 Date: 01 Jul 1865; MusterOut 2 Information: Mustered Out;
Title: Official Roster of the Soldiers of the State of Ohio

Ancestry: "U.S., Civil War Soldiers, 1861-1865", collection.
Name: David Gatchel
Side: Union
Regiment State/Origin: West Virginia
Regiment: 2nd Regiment, West Virginia Veteran Infantry
Company: C
Rank In: Sergeant
Rank Out: Sergeant
Film Number: M507 roll 5

Familysearch, " West Virginia Civil War Service Records of Union Soldiers, 1861-1865"
Company Descriptive Book of Co. C 2nd Reg.
Age: 36
Eyes: grey
Hair: dark
Complexion; fair
Height: 5' 8 1/2"
Birth Year (Estimated) 1826
Where Born: Harrison County Ohio
Occupation: Farmer
Enlistment: 24 Jan 1864
Where: Larkinsville, Alabama
By Whom: Captain Russell
Term: 3 yrs
Military Unit: Miscellaneous Card Abstracts of Records
Event Type: Military Service
Event Date: 1864
Event Place: West Virginia
Event Place (Original): West Virginia
Affiliate Publication Number: M508
Affiliate Publication Title: Compiled Service Records of Volunteer Union Soldiers Who Served in Organizations from the State of West Virginia

Familysearch: " Indiana Marriages, 1811-2019" collection.
Name: David Gatchel
Sex: Male
Spouse's Name: Laura B Rowley
Spouse's Sex: Female
Officiator's Name: Rev. D R Hix
Clerk: Louis Dwyer
Marriage Place: Indiana
Marriage License Date: 29 Apr 1887
Marriage License Place: Perry, Indiana, United States
Event Type: Marriage License
Page: 213
Number of Images: 1

Ancestry: " Indiana, U.S., Death Certificates, 1899-2011", collection.
Death certificate: #26
Birth: 17 Dec 1924, 87 yrs, 4 mo., 10 dys
Date of death: 27 Apr 1912 9:25 AM
Cause of death: arteriosclerosis, contributory bronchial pneumonia.
Attending: Hardin S. Dome MD
Date of burial: 30 Apr 1912, Tell City, Perry, Indiana
Father: Joseph Gatchel
Mother: Elizabeth Suddeth
Occupation: Retired Farmer
Informant: Laura Gatchel wife, Telly City, Indiana
Undertaker: C.L. Schuyler, License #277, Tell City, Indiana

Tell City Journal, 1 May 1912, David Gatchel, CW Vet, City Cemetery.

Tell City News, 4 May 1912, David C. Gatchel, 90y 4m 10d, obituary, City Cemetery.
